SHORTESS, Judge.

In 1964 William C. Hayward, Sr., and his wife Helene R. Hayward formed a corporation called "Germania Plantation, Inc." (Germania).1 The articles of incorporation contain a provision in Article V which requires a stockholder who desires to sell Germania stock to first offer it for sale to his fellow shareholders.
